Just to add to the debate….if an when (and I think the time is drawing near) that Precursor crafting is released (yeah, I could be delusional), keep in mind it will likely be done by releasing an entirely NEW set of Legendary Weapons (I think this is one of the reasons for the delay….they cannot upset the current Precuror/Legendary markets (directly)).
A new set of Legendary Weapons present the following possiblities:
- Weapons may be desirable visually and thus become “the flavor of the month” items. This means whatever is required to obtain the new ones will have huge demand and will likely reduce demand for the old items….including the older Precursors (at least for a limited time). This will likely result in a sharp drop in current Precursor prices on the TP (likely to happen mere moments after any news of the new Legendary Weapons leaks).
- If the new Legendary Weapons are similarly forged, then all Mats associated with making them will also rise in price.
Pure speculation above.

If you’re going to buy a precursor, putting in a buy order is worthwhile and will save you a lot. I bought a precursor to make a legendary for my husband and the order was filled in less than 24 hours (and saved me in excess of 100g).
Put in a buy order for whatever you can afford today. Any time your wallet can afford it, drop that offer and create a new one that’s 20-30g higher. Eventually, someone will accept an offer. Everyone I know who uses this technique has gotten their precursor for well below the going rate at the time.
This does a couple of things, mostly psychological (the greatest obstacle to acquiring a precursor now):
- It hides your money, so you don’t accidentally spend it on impulse purchases or the latest cool skin.
- It keeps you from checking the TP every day. You’ll only check when your wallet starts to build up.
- It allows you to notice your progress towards your goal, matching your experience with accumulating T6 mats and lodestones (if needed). Each time you look, you’ll have made a good chunk of progress.
- It keeps you from obsessing over the magnitude of the goal. In perspective, a precursor is never more than 3/5 of the total cost of a legendary (and it’s less than 40% for more than half of them). However, since you never see the total cost of any single “gift,” those always seem less daunting, even though many are worth 100s of gold, too.
The only people who save money by forging for precursors are the 1/10% who are extremely lucky or the small group of people that invest 1,000s of gold on a regular basis; the law of large numbers works for them, but work against those of us unwilling to risk that much.
